Output 05a1a1d6e1b8d8e46571a4fca89c1756bff8f53117f820a5e6790cfb960272fe:1

value
17519649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83abae5e772e7d7513fc6e9697aa38ae3a4a94fd OP_EQUAL
address
3DhE7HdQFs4Q7Q5DrWsvGHZFGgm241rnhW
transaction
05a1a1d6e1b8d8e46571a4fca89c1756bff8f53117f820a5e6790cfb960272fe
confirmations
401446
spent
true